New Release – The Prince of Shadows

My fantasy novella is now available on Amazon!  It’s the first book in a new series about the Versovian Empire.
cover

He knows what he was born to be.

Seventeen-year old Kesan is both an illegitimate prince and a rare golemist–an Elemage that can call golems of fire, water, earth, and air. However, instead of accepting his status and honing his gifts, he’d rather live his life as a normal villager, spending his days with Isa, the girl he loves.

Now he must choose who he is meant to be. 

When a malevolent spirit gives Isa what she wants most, Kesan will have to call upon the two things he’d rather deny to save his village and all he loves.

Genre: young adult, dark fantasy
Word count: ~24,300 (novella)

“Howls in the Moonlight” Published as a Kindle Ebook!

My first book in the Howls in the Night trilogy is out and available as a Kindle Ebook here!

Belle Knight isn’t your typical werewolf. She’s stronger and faster and can kick ass just as well as she can cook. 

And as a chef, her meals are amazing. 

Only one problem: in her quest to strengthen her inner wolf and protect those she loves, she’s forgotten what it’s like to view life as a normal human. However, when Max Greyson walks into her life, being a human doesn’t seem half as bad anymore. 

In fact, hiding her werewolf side at the moment isn’t a bad idea since she and her pack are being targeted by Hunters. It’s a good thing she has Max to help her fight her ruthless enemies. 

Max just has to make sure the woman he’s falling for doesn’t find out that he’s the Hunter sent to destroy her.
